The Digital Millenium Copyright Act (1998) states that universities, as the main internet service provider for the school, are responsible for preventing online copyright infringment among students. ASU strives to inform students of the risks of copyright infringement and illegal downloading.

The Higher Education Opportunity Act requires academic institutions to educate students on copyright and DMCA issues, Prevent inappropriate use of peer-to-peer programs and software, and suggest alternative downloading programs (Pandora, Itunes, etc.)
